This is an annual initiative in March, that promotes education and encourages young people to make decisions about their future, run by a not-for-profit community interest company. National Careers Week connects students, educators, and employers to highlight the wide range of career opportunities with their aim being ‘to provide a focus for careers guidance activity at an important stage in the academic calendar to help support young people develop awareness and excitement about their future pathways’.
